Is 120 GSM Good Quality?

When evaluating paper quality, 120 GSM is considered a good option for a variety of uses. GSM, or grams per square meter, is a metric that measures the weight of paper, indicating its thickness and durability. Typically, 120 GSM paper is thicker and more robust than standard printer paper, making it suitable for brochures, posters, and high-quality prints.

What Does GSM Mean in Paper Quality?

GSM stands for grams per square meter and is a standard measurement for paper weight. It reflects the paper’s thickness and density, which influence its durability and feel. Here’s a quick breakdown of common GSM ranges and their typical uses:

  • 80-100 GSM: Standard office paper, ideal for everyday printing and copying.
  • 120-150 GSM: Heavier paper, suitable for professional documents, brochures, and flyers.
  • 160-200 GSM: Cardstock, often used for business cards, invitations, and covers.
  • 200+ GSM: Heavy cardstock, used for packaging, folders, and premium prints.

Why Choose 120 GSM Paper?

120 GSM paper strikes a balance between weight and flexibility, providing several benefits for both personal and professional use:

  • Durability: Thicker than standard paper, 120 GSM is less prone to tearing and creasing.
  • Professional Appearance: It offers a premium feel, enhancing the presentation of documents and marketing materials.
  • Versatility: Suitable for both inkjet and laser printers, making it a versatile choice for various printing needs.

When Should You Use 120 GSM Paper?

Choosing the right paper weight depends on the intended use. Here are some scenarios where 120 GSM paper is ideal:

  • Brochures and Flyers: Provides a professional look and feel, making marketing materials stand out.
  • Reports and Presentations: Enhances the quality of printed documents, giving them a polished finish.
  • Photographs and Art Prints: Offers a good balance of thickness and flexibility, ensuring high-quality prints.

What Are the Benefits of Using 120 GSM Paper?

  • Enhanced Print Quality: The smooth surface allows for sharp text and vivid images.
  • Reduced Show-through: Thicker paper minimizes ink bleed and show-through, ensuring clarity.
  • Eco-Friendly Options: Many 120 GSM papers are available in recycled and sustainable options.

Is 120 GSM Paper Suitable for Double-Sided Printing?

Yes, 120 GSM paper is suitable for double-sided printing. Its thickness reduces ink bleed-through, making it an excellent choice for documents that require printing on both sides.

Can I Use 120 GSM Paper in Any Printer?

Most modern printers can handle 120 GSM paper, but it’s always best to check your printer’s specifications. Both inkjet and laser printers generally support this weight.

What Is the Difference Between 120 GSM and 150 GSM?

The primary difference lies in thickness and durability. 150 GSM paper is thicker and more durable than 120 GSM, often used for covers and premium prints, while 120 GSM is versatile for everyday professional use.

How Does GSM Affect Print Quality?

Higher GSM typically results in better print quality. Thicker paper like 120 GSM provides a smoother surface, enhancing the sharpness of printed text and images.

Is 120 GSM Paper Recyclable?

Yes, most 120 GSM papers are recyclable. It’s advisable to check for any coatings or finishes that might affect recyclability.
